A red ribbon template is essentially a pre-designed graphic asset that provides a consistent and scalable foundation for your projects. Instead of manually drawing the curve and shading for every single project, you can utilize a standardized file to ensure brand cohesion across various platforms. This resource is available in numerous file formats, including PNG for web use, SVG for vector scaling, and PSD for detailed editing in software like Adobe Photoshop.

Health and Awareness Campaigns
Perhaps the most recognized use of this template is in health-related advocacy. The red ribbon is globally synonymous with HIV/AIDS awareness, making it an essential tool for non-profits and public health departments. Utilizing a template ensures that campaign materials—from posters to social media graphics—maintain a unified and professional look that reinforces the seriousness of the cause.

| File Format | Best Use Case | Scalability |
|---|---|---|
| PNG | Web graphics and email campaigns | Raster; may pixelate when enlarged |
| SVG | Print materials and responsive web design | Vector; infinitely scalable |
| PSD | Advanced editing and customization | Depends on resolution |
Customization and Branding
While the standard template provides a structure, the true value lies in the ability to customize it. Designers can adjust the color saturation to move from a bright, intense red to a deeper, burgundy tone to match specific brand guidelines. Adding textures, gradients, or subtle shadows can also elevate the template from a simple icon to a sophisticated design element that aligns with a company’s visual identity.

When implementing a red ribbon template, it is crucial to consider the surrounding composition. The negative space around the ribbon is just as important as the ribbon itself. Ensuring there is adequate contrast between the red element and the background will guarantee that the message is legible and the visual impact is maximized for the intended audience.
